In the work of Chris Gillis, visual elements and/or printing techniques are taken out of their original context, recycled and deconstructed, to ultimately form the foundation for a new story. Chris Gillis draws on a variety of sources. Aspects of the biographical and everyday perception, elements from landscape and architecture. These become intertwined with each other or are reduced to abstract areas of color. All these sources undergo a recycling process, in a collage-like manner. Sometimes controlled, sometimes spontaneously created. In the same way a dream works, several impressions are transformed into a synthesis of reality.
